Macassa Mine's Immigration Initiative: A Sustainable Workforce Solution

Diverse group of professionals celebrating with award for Macassa Mine Immigration Initiative.

A New Model for Workforce Planning at Macassa Mine

The Macassa Mine, operated by Agnico Eagle in Kirkland Lake, Ontario, has garnered attention for its innovative Skilled Trades Relocation Initiative, addressing the severe shortage of specialized labor in the mining industry. This pilot project, which relocated twelve skilled workers from Mexico along with their families, was honored with the prestigious 2024 Michel Létourneau Award for demonstrating exemplary teamwork and productivity improvements.

Why Immigration Matters in the Mining Sector

The Canadian mining industry, particularly in remote areas like Kirkland Lake, has faced ongoing recruitment challenges. Despite posting numerous job openings locally and sorting through hundreds of applications, many positions remain unfilled. Heavy-duty equipment mechanics, a critical role in mining operations, are particularly hard to source. This situation propelled Agnico Eagle to look beyond traditional recruitment methods and consider international workers who have the necessary skills and fit into the company culture.

Breaking Down Barriers with Community Support

Agnico Eagle's initiative included comprehensive support systems for the relocated employees and their families. Before the move, the company worked closely with potential candidates, conducting Labour Market Impact Assessments to ensure they were a good fit. Following their arrival last year, they received assistance from the Kirkland Lake Multicultural Group, which helped with essential services such as health cards, driver's licenses, and cultural integration, including a Spanish-language guide for surviving Canadian winters. This holistic approach not only facilitated the workers' transition but also fostered a sense of belonging within the community.

Positive Outcomes and Future Implications

The success of the Skilled Trades Relocation Initiative has set a precedent for future workforce planning in the mining sector. Since the families' arrival, they have poorly integrated, considering permanent residency and taking on supervisory roles within the mine. Mariana Pinheiro, the general manager of Macassa, remarked on the positive outcomes: "We didn’t realize how big an undertaking it would be, but the results have been so positive." This speaks volumes, emphasizing the potential benefits of utilizing immigration as a tool to address workforce gaps in critical industries.

John Mason's Appointment Signals Bright Future for Clean Air Metals' Mining Aspirations

Update John Mason Joins Clean Air Metals: What This Means for Ontario's Mining FutureIn a significant move for the mining industry, Clean Air Metals Inc. has appointed John Mason, a seasoned geoscientist with nearly five decades of experience, as a new director. Mason, who has a storied career in mineral exploration and mining in Northern Ontario, will bring valuable expertise and connections as the company advances its Thunder Bay North Critical Minerals Project.What Makes John Mason a Key Asset?Mason’s background includes high-level management roles with the Ontario Ministry of Northern Development and Mines, underscoring his extensive knowledge in geological exploration and regulatory frameworks. Having previously served as the manager for the Thunder Bay Community Economic Development Commission, Mason understands the intricacies of local economies intertwined with mining endeavors. He has worked closely with various Indigenous communities and municipalities to foster economic development while maintaining a strong focus on environmental responsibility and ESG standards.The Thunder Bay North Project: Potential UncoveredThe Thunder Bay North Critical Minerals Project, located just 40 km northeast of Thunder Bay, is particularly promising as it houses two significant deposits—Current and Escape—both of which are on the verge of expanded mineral resource estimates. With a combined resource estimated at 13.8 million tonnes, including 2.4 million ounces of platinum equivalent, the project positions Clean Air Metals as a contender in the global mining landscape, particularly for investors interested in sustainable mineral sources.Community and Government Relationships: Building a Sustainable FutureChairman Jim Gallagher has highlighted Mason's existing rapport with community and government entities as crucial for the Thunder Bay North Project's advancement. Securing funding through provincial and federal programs will be pivotal, especially in light of increasing focus on critical minerals needed for renewable energy technologies and electric vehicles. Mason’s appointment signals an intention to leverage these relationships effectively to ensure the project’s success.Engaging with Indigenous CommunitiesOne of the focal points of Clean Air Metals’ operations has been its engagement with First Nations. The Thunder Bay North Project is situated in the area covered by the Robinson-Superior Treaty of 1850, incorporating territories important to the local Indigenous groups. Clean Air Metals has acknowledged these communities' rights and continues to prioritize their involvement and feedback in project developments, which is crucial in ensuring mutual benefits from the resource extraction processes.Looking Ahead: What’s Next for Clean Air Metals?With John Mason on board, Clean Air Metals is poised for a strategic push towards exploring more of its mineral asset potential while aligning with modern governance standards. The granting of stock options also signals confidence in the company’s trajectory; these options can incentivize directors to drive company performance. Mason’s expertise will undoubtedly play a central role in navigating the complexities of permitting, financing, and eventual construction of the Thunder Bay North Project.A New Era for Ontario's Mining SectorThe future seems bright for Clean Air Metals and its quest to tap into Ontario's mineral wealth. As global demand for critical minerals rises and the mining industry pivots towards sustainability, projects like Thunder Bay North could not only provide economic benefits but also bolster environmental stewardship in mining practices. Stakeholders and investors watching Clean Air Metals will likely be keen to see how Mason’s leadership influences developments in this critical sector.

Discover How the New Sudbury Institute Will Revolutionize Northern Housing Solutions

Update Innovative Solutions for Northern Housing Challenges The soon-to-open Institute for Northern Housing Innovation in Sudbury represents a bold step forward in addressing the pressing housing needs of Northern Ontario. Slated to begin operations in the fall of 2026, this initiative aims to merge academic research with practical applications in the residential construction sector. Unlike traditional academic entities that may gather dust with mere reports, this institute is dedicated to fostering a dynamic environment where innovative housing technologies can be developed, tested, and ultimately deployed where they are needed most. A Hub of Collaboration and Technology Transfer At the helm of this ambitious project is Dr. Steven Beites, who envisions the institute as an incubator for innovative ideas. The institute will be a collaborative effort bringing together experts from various fields to facilitate technology transfer—a process through which successful innovations are moved into the marketplace. As stated by Beites, "We can begin to act as an incubator and facilitate the transfer of successful innovations to the marketplace." This goal aligns with the growing imperative for sustainable and affordable housing solutions, as conventional methods often fall short in meeting the unique challenges of Northern Ontario. High-Tech Facilities Driving Forward-Thinking Solutions The institute will be housed within a newly constructed 3,000-square-foot facility, complete with state-of-the-art equipment, including robotics and materials testing machinery. This lab will enable hands-on experimentation, crucial for refining concepts before they reach construction sites. Notably, the funding for this initiative, exceeding $1.25 million, comes from a variety of sources, including provincial support, which underscores the importance of community-driven solutions. Building on Experience and Community Engagement In establishing the institute, the team draws from extensive experience realized during past collaborations on housing projects. Dr. Beites has led graduate studio courses for several years, managing real-life architectural and engineering projects for non-profit organizations. Through these programs, he recognized the need for a dedicated space where such projects could flourish beyond the constraints of an academic calendar. “It’s incredibly rewarding,” Beites shares, reflecting on the value of engaging students in community-focused projects that deliver tangible outcomes. Challenges of Aligning Academic Timelines With Community Needs This vital connection between academia and community response often presents challenges—particularly when project timelines are tightly bound by academic semesters. The necessity for a longer, more flexible approach is at the core of the institute's mission, allowing for thorough exploration and refinement of housing innovations. Dr. Beites' experience underscores a common frustration among educators and community builders alike: the difficulty in compressing complex social initiatives into short academic stints.
